The video discusses the production of Fender guitars, highlighting their design for mass production and the cost-effectiveness of manufacturing in Mexico compared to Japan and China. It explains how Fender uses American parts assembled in Mexico due to lower labor costs and environmental regulations that restrict certain manufacturing processes in California.
